The New Mal–Changrabandha–New Cooch Behar line are a set of 2 lines which connect Changrabandha, a border transit point near Indo-Bangladesh border in Cooch Behar district with the stations of New Mal in Jalpaiguri district and New Cooch Behar in Cooch Behar district of West Bengal.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Changrabandha is a census town and a gram panchayat in Mekhliganj CD block in Mekhliganj subdivision of Cooch Behar district in the state of West Bengal, India. It is a border checkpoint on the Bangladesh-India border. Changrabandha is situated 10 km southeast of Bhotepati.
